Femtosecond resolved mega-gauss magnetic field evolution in an intense laser generated solid plasma

Abstract

We report the first femtosecond resolved evolution of the giant magnetic field in a solid plasma, produced by a 100 fs, 1016 W cm-2, 806 nm laser field, using a pump-probe Faraday rotation technique.
